Top Antitussive Options: Finding the Best Cough Suppressant for Relief
Ever had one of those annoying coughs that just won’t quit? Yeah, me too. It can really mess with your day. So let’s chat about antitussives—those handy little helpers that might make life a tad easier when you’re fighting off a cough.
What are antitussives? Well, they’re basically medications that suppress your cough reflex. You know, the thing that makes you go “ugh” when you’re trying to enjoy a movie or have a nice dinner.
Types of Antitussives: There are a couple main types out there:
- Codeine: This is an opioid and works pretty well at calming that pesky cough down. But it can come with some side effects, like drowsiness.
- Dextromethorphan (DM): You find this one in many over-the-counter (OTC) cough syrups. It’s popular and usually doesn’t cause drowsiness—that’s what many folks like about it!
- Benzonatate: This one’s different; it numbs the throat to help stop the urge to cough. Great for those scratchy throat moments!
Now, don’t get too excited! Just because they’re available doesn’t mean they’re for everyone. Sometimes, especially if your cough is productive (that means you’re coughing stuff up), these meds aren’t always the best choice.
And here’s something important: Make sure to read labels! Some products combine antitussives with other ingredients like decongestants or antihistamines. So, if you’re dealing with allergies or flu-like symptoms, consider what else you might need.
